The emergency release cord is pulled to disconnect the door from the opener trolley in Wheatland. The door is manually lifted in Wheatland, WY. If the door lifts easily and holds its position, the opener is the source of the problem in Wheatland. If the door is very heavy or won't hold a raised position, the spring has failed and the opener symptom is a consequence of the spring failure in Wheatland, WY. If the door won't move at all manually, the door is physically stuck from a cable failure, track obstruction, or off-track condition in Wheatland. A broken torsion spring removes the counterbalancing force that makes the door movable by the opener in Wheatland, WY. The opener provides 10 to 20 pounds of net lifting force against a counterbalanced door in Wheatland. Without spring counterbalancing, the opener is trying to lift 150 to 400 pounds with 10 to 20 pounds of force in Wheatland, WY. The manual release test reveals a heavy door that won't hold its position in Wheatland. A visible gap in the torsion spring coil confirms the break in Wheatland, WY.
A broken cable allows one side of the door to drop, tilting the door in the track in Wheatland. The tilted door is physically jammed against the track walls and can't travel in either direction in Wheatland, WY. The manual release test reveals a door that won't move at all in Wheatland. Inspection finds a loose cable at the bottom corner of the lower side in Wheatland, WY. Cable replacement and spring assessment are required in Wheatland.

The emergency release cord disconnects the trolley carriage from the trolley in Wheatland. If the carriage was disconnected and not reconnected, the opener runs the trolley along the rail while the carriage and door sit stationary in Wheatland, WY. The door appears completely unopened and unresponsive in Wheatland. The manual release test reveals a door that lifts easily because the carriage is already disconnected in Wheatland, WY. Reconnecting the carriage to the trolley resolves the symptom immediately in Wheatland. No component is damaged or failed in Wheatland, WY.

A dead remote battery produces a door that doesn't respond to the remote in Wheatland, WY. The wall button will operate the door normally in Wheatland. If the door opens with the wall button but not the remote, replace the remote battery before calling for service in Wheatland, WY. A new battery resolves this in approximately two minutes in Wheatland. If the door doesn't respond to either the remote or the wall button, the problem is in the opener or door hardware and a service call is warranted in Wheatland, WY.
In cold climates, water from condensation or melting snow freezes at the contact point between the door's bottom seal and the garage floor overnight in Wheatland. The frozen bond holds the door to the floor despite the opener providing its normal lifting force in Wheatland, WY. The manual release test typically reveals a door that's very difficult to lift manually as the ice bond resists upward force in Wheatland. Gentle heat application at the floor seal breaks the ice bond in most cases in Wheatland, WY. Do not run the opener repeatedly against a frozen door in Wheatland.
An object in the track, debris accumulation at a specific point, or a bent track section narrows the channel below the roller diameter in Wheatland. The door opens to the obstruction point and stops in Wheatland, WY. The manual release test may show the door lifting partially and then stopping at the obstruction in Wheatland. Track clearing or track repair is required to restore full travel in Wheatland, WY.
Before any other action, try the wall button inside the garage in Wheatland, WY. If the wall button opens the door, the problem is with the remote rather than the door or opener in Wheatland. Replace the remote battery first in Wheatland, WY. If the wall button also produces no response, the problem is in the opener or door hardware and EZ Open's service is needed in Wheatland.
Look at the opener trolley and the carriage bracket that connects to the door in Wheatland. If the carriage hook is hanging freely rather than engaged in the trolley, the emergency release was pulled and not reconnected in Wheatland, WY. Pull the red emergency release cord toward the door to re-engage the carriage in Wheatland. If the door then opens with the opener, no repair was needed in Wheatland, WY.
Look at the torsion spring on the shaft above the door opening in Wheatland, WY. A broken spring has a visible gap in the otherwise continuous coil where the wire separated in Wheatland. If a gap is visible, do not attempt to open the door in Wheatland, WY. Call EZ Open for same-day broken spring repair in Wheatland.
Running the opener repeatedly against a door that won't open risks stripping the drive gear in Wheatland. Manually pulling a door that's jammed from a cable failure or off-track condition can damage the panel at the force application point in Wheatland, WY. Forcing a door with a broken cable can release the door suddenly in Wheatland. The cost of the forced damage adds to whatever the original repair cost would have been in Wheatland, WY.
If you must access the garage before EZ Open arrives in Wheatland, WY, use the external keyed emergency release if your door has one in Wheatland. If not, use the manual release cord carefully with at least one other person present in Wheatland, WY. With a broken spring, the door is very heavy and will not hold a raised position in Wheatland. Lift only the minimum amount required and do not stand under the door in Wheatland, WY.
